Аннотация:The cytoarchitectonics of speech motor fields 44 and 45 of the brain were studied in five adult men and five women. Total frontal sections of thickness 20 um were stained with cresyl violet for measurement of the thickness of the cortex and its layers, profile field areas of neurons in layers 11] and V, neuron density in layer III of field 45, satellite glial cell density, and the density of neurons surrounded by satellite glial cells. Both men and women showed a tendency to left-hemisphere dominance in the values of a number of cytoarchitectonic measures — the thickness of associative layer III, the profile field areas of neurons in this layer, and increases in the proportions of large and very large sizes in this layer. lnterhemisphere differences in these parameters were more marked in men than women. A number of indictors of sexual dimorphism were identified in men and women. The most significant of these were increases in the densities of neurons, satellite glial cells. and neurons surrounded by satellite glial cells in women as compared with men.
